Course Structure
The course offers:
Business Improvement Project specific to your organisation with a strategic focus (Unit 524 Conducting a Management Project)
A series of workshops to introduce new concepts, inspire development, promote practical application and offer networking opportunities e.g. Leading with impact; Powerful Communication; Managing Group Dynamics; and Empowering, Inspiring 30 hours executive coaching per candidate
Each candidate will be matched with a Coach working at Executive Level with significant experience and European Mentoring and Coaching Council membership. This will help identify strengths and areas for development, providing candidates with the necessary tools to explore and develop their leadership and management potential.
Contact Hours
The course will run for 4 hours per week for 8 weeks.
Entry Requirements
A minimum of 12 months experience in a middle managerial role OR minimum of 36 months experience as supervisor/team leader: Or a Business Owner and have the ability to carry out independent research and complete assignments.
Should hold L3 qualification or higher.
The course is offered under Skill UP - The flexible skills fund provided you meet the following criteria:
(a) over 18 years of age;
(b) eligible to work in Northern Ireland;
(c) ‘settled’ in Northern Ireland, and has been ordinarily resident in the UK for at least three years; or
(d) is a person who has indefinite leave to enter or remain in the UK.
